Forum » Programiranje » Potrditev vpisa v podatkovno bazo
Potrditev vpisa v podatkovno bazo

mirch ::
Sem začetnik v programiranju in me muči ena preprostaa stvar ..
.. namreč v novem obrazcu z končnico .aspx, delam preprost vpis v podatkovno bazo. Z klikom na gumb, pa bi navedeno v "textbox" vpisalo v bazo. Trenutno mi vpiše v bazo, ampak ne dobim nobenega potrdila da je vpisano, ter vrsti ostanejo polne. Torej kako naredim, da ko dodam v podatkovno bazo novo informacijo, potrdilo da je ta informacija vpisana? Ter, da mi resetira "textbox" oziroma pripravi za nov vpis?
Delam v programu VisualStudio;)
.. namreč v novem obrazcu z končnico .aspx, delam preprost vpis v podatkovno bazo. Z klikom na gumb, pa bi navedeno v "textbox" vpisalo v bazo. Trenutno mi vpiše v bazo, ampak ne dobim nobenega potrdila da je vpisano, ter vrsti ostanejo polne. Torej kako naredim, da ko dodam v podatkovno bazo novo informacijo, potrdilo da je ta informacija vpisana? Ter, da mi resetira "textbox" oziroma pripravi za nov vpis?
Delam v programu VisualStudio;)

Mitja Bonča ::
Ali uporabljaš ExecuteNonQuery() metodo? Če jo, potem lahko z njo dobiš število zapisov v bazo.
Primer:
Mitja
Primer:
private void Zapisi(string a, string b)
{
using (SqlConnection sqlConn = new SqlConnection("connString"))
{
string query = "INSERT INTO Tabla VALUES (a = @a, b = @b)";
SqlCommand cmd = new SqlCommand(query, sqlConn);
cmd.Parameters.Add("@a", SqlDbType.VarChar, 50).Value = a;
cmd.Parameters.Add("@b", SqlDbType.VarChar, 50).Value = b;
cmd.Connection = sqlConn;
sqlConn.Open();
try
{
int vrstic = cmd.ExecuteNonQuery();
MessageBox.Show("Vnos " + vrstic + ".vrsric je bil uspešno izveden.");
}
catch (Exception ex)
{
MessageBox.Show("Napaka:\n" + ex.Message);
}
}
}
Mitja

mirch ::
Brez zamere, da vprašam nasljednje:
Katere parametre moram vse prilagodit, da bo delalo v moji kodi?
Oprosti, sem še čist frišn v tem:)
"Tabla" zamenjam z imenom svoje tabele .. še kaj druga?
Katere parametre moram vse prilagodit, da bo delalo v moji kodi?
Oprosti, sem še čist frišn v tem:)
"Tabla" zamenjam z imenom svoje tabele .. še kaj druga?
Vredno ogleda ...
Tema | Ogledi | Zadnje sporočilo | |
---|---|---|---|
Tema | Ogledi | Zadnje sporočilo | |
» | SQL problemOddelek: Programiranje | 1749 (1367) | win64 |
» | C# INSERT statment ne vpise podatkovOddelek: Programiranje | 1249 (1123) | darkolord |
» | Napaka pri povezavi z bazo - c#Oddelek: Programiranje | 1047 (911) | Mitja Bonča |
» | [Visual C#] TableAdapterOddelek: Programiranje | 1191 (1067) | detroit |
» | Statistika dijakov, pomocOddelek: Programiranje | 1856 (1340) | Mitja Bonča |